What are Colonoscopy Preparation Instructions?
Colonoscopy preparation instructions are vital for ensuring accurate and effective results during the procedure. These guidelines typically involve dietary restrictions, medication guidelines, and specific fluid intake requirements to ensure proper colon cleansing. Various preparation methods include PEG-ELS and sodium phosphate tablets, each with defined protocols that patients must follow closely. Adhering to the colonoscopy prep guide will enhance the success of the diagnostic process.
Why are Colonoscopy Preparation Instructions Important?
Following precise colonoscopy preparation instructions is essential for achieving accurate results. Proper preparation helps ensure that the colon is adequately cleansed, allowing for a clear view during the procedure. Inadequate preparation can pose risks such as incomplete views and missed diagnoses, underscoring the importance of adhering to physician-recommended guidelines for both safety and effectiveness.
